All metals have their characteristics and PhBr is no exception. I wouldn't advise anyone new to metal turning to start on it as I think a lot of material could be wasted before getting a part that you are happy with. PhBr requires well sharpened tooling - a skill in itself.

To make a handle up from solid like you have pictured would not be straight forward either. As well as the lathe to turn the outside you will need a mill with rotary table for the inside (unless you want to spend a lot of time chain drilling and filing) and may be even some special cutters. CNC makes it easier of course but I'd suggest that you are looking at several hours of machine time each. Brass plating is going to be the cheapest way I think.

On the electroplating idea. Brass is an alloy of Copper and Zinc. The two metals do electroplate at different voltages, meaning that you will only plate one metal onto another, until this is exhausted. Then the voltage goes up and you electroplate the other metal. One layer over another is not the result that you wanted. There are tricks using high currents and toxic cyanide baths to deposit both metals together, but it is not easy to control the process and the quality of the end result may not be good enough.

But are you really locked-in into that brass look? You know, if you do not coat polished Brass with clear Zapon lacquer it very soon discolours. Its called a "patina", some people like an antique looking patina others think it looks cheap and dirty. If you handle it a lot like you will a handwheel, the laquer will wear off soon, looking even worse than if you left the brass uncoated with a natural patina. If you were not completely locked-in to a brass look, how about copper plating? Copper plating is very simple and easy to do DIY. Copper too will acquire a patina, just like brass.

If you are locked-into this "golden" brass look... by now you have found out that a suitable size slice of brass or bronze is not cheap, and it takes a bit of work to turn/mill into a nice handwheel. Would you consider buying a suitable off the shelf and cheap steel handwheel, and have it..... (please do not laugh or discard the idea thinking it is far too expensive).... and have it gold electroplated instead? Seriously, think about it, gold looks very much like brass yet it will not oxidize and turn dark. And I would think a few microns of pure Gold coating is not as expensive as making a one off brass handwheel. Maybe ask a jeweler if he could electroplate your wheel. Or if more adventurous, there are DIY Gold plating kits.

I have no practical experience at Gold plating. Except the chemical plating method that is used in electronics to plate the contact strips of circuit boards. But I never tried Gold electroplating.
I think you first would have to electroplate your steel handwhhel with Copper. Copper is easy to apply and has an excellent adhesion. Then you need to add a coat of Nickel that prevents copper atoms to over time diffuse into the thin Gold layer and cause discoloration. You do not want your handwheel to look like a fake Chinese $50 Rolex watch after a couple years. Do a Google search, there are many sources for Gold plating. This is just an overview: http://en.wikipedia.org/wiki/Gold_plating. In doubt, ask a jeweler if he can do it for you.

Scrap gold from old jewellry may not be ideally suited. For one it could be just plated a few microns, and Silver underneath. But second, jewelry is never pure (24K) Gold, but most usually an 18K alloy (18k=75% Gold content, the remainder are metals to give it a particular color like Rhodium to make White Gold or Copper to make it Red Gold). Pure gold would also be too soft for jewelry. And Gold jewelry for kids is often only 9K, so to keep it affordable to teenagers. Your nuggets could be purer than you think, the average Gold contents in a nugget is 85-90%. They say the more orange it looks, the higher the content.

TT I would think, but could be proved wrong, that you would get plenty of bronze to cast a wheel or alternatively cast a blank to machine your wheel from a scrap dealer much cheaper than buying new bar stock. If you are able to cast either wheel or a machinable blank, old bronze gate valve bodies might be the go. As far as I know, many gate valves use bronze for the body, but may use brass for the gate and spindle. The bodies have a reddish brass colour while the gate and spindle will be more yellow. For your application it may not matter if you used the whole lot, but it may be more difficult to machine, - I don't know but others will jump in hopefully and inform us all.
Did you particularly want to use Phosphor Bronze for any reason? The reason I ask it is a slightly specialised copper alloy, and might be a bit more expensive than more garden variety brasses, again I can't say for sure, but I suspect that it may be the case. I would think that any brass / bronze alloy would be strong enough, but other issues such as colour or ease of machining may be upper-most in your thinking on this. good luck with your project anyway, and brass or bronze, brass plated or plated in gold, you have a good range of options to choose from, and some with lots of cachet to boot!

Since you showed the limited edition Benchcrafted bronze wheel, I thought it worth mentioning the other finish they tried.
This was to give an iron wheel a dark bronze patina in the same way as seasoning a cast iron pan.
Basically a thin coat of flax seed / raw linseed oil and cooked in the oven (repeat 4 or 5 times).
Looks good, corrosion resistant and very cost effective: http://benchcrafted.blogspot.com.au/2011/09/omega-3-fatty-acid-for-your-cast-iron.html
